Download hubble vs james webb a stunning visual comparison

Duration: (6:28) 2025-02-03T16:17:29+00:00



hubble vs james webb a stunning visual comparison hubble vs james webb a stunning visual comparison hubble vs james webb a stunning visual comparison

Description
Download this and online watch hubble vs james webb a stunning visual comparison
Related videos

Mxtube.net